## The Essence of Luxury: Materials and Craftsmanship
The first impression of a luxury car interior is often dictated by the materials used. Forget plastic and vinyl – these spaces embrace premium materials that exude quality and elegance.
* **Leather:** A staple of luxury, leather upholstery is known for its supple feel, natural beauty, and durability. From soft Nappa leather to the exotic hide of cows raised for their exceptional hides, carmakers carefully select leather for its unique characteristics and appeal.
* **Wood:** Natural wood veneers add warmth, sophistication, and visual interest to the cabin. From rich walnut and maple to rare burled wood, each piece is meticulously selected, cut, and finished to create a tactile and aesthetic masterpiece.
* **Metal:** Aluminum, chrome, and stainless steel accents add a touch of industrial chic and visual contrast. These materials are used in trim pieces, door handles, and other details, reflecting light and adding a touch of luxury.
Beyond the materials themselves, craftsmanship plays a critical role in elevating the interior experience.
* **Stitching:** Hand-stitched seams are a hallmark of luxury. The meticulous attention to detail, the precision of each stitch, and the subtle variations in color and texture create a sense of bespoke quality.
* **Attention to Detail:** Every element, from the design of the air vents to the shape of the door handles, is carefully considered and crafted to enhance the overall aesthetic and functionality.
* **Exclusivity:** Many luxury car interiors are available in limited edition trims and materials, offering a heightened sense of exclusivity and customization.
## Technology: Enhancing the Driving Experience
Luxury car interiors are not just about aesthetics; they are also designed to enhance the driving experience. Technology plays a crucial role in creating a seamless and intuitive environment for the driver and passengers.
* **Digital Dashboards:** Instead of traditional analog gauges, many luxury cars feature digital displays that provide a wealth of information at a glance. Customizable layouts, vivid graphics, and intuitive controls enhance the driver’s awareness and control.
* **Head-up Displays:** Projected onto the windshield, head-up displays (HUDs) display vital information like speed, navigation instructions, and safety alerts directly within the driver’s line of sight, reducing distractions and enhancing safety.
* **Infotainment Systems:** Luxury car interiors are equipped with cutting-edge infotainment systems that offer seamless connectivity, entertainment, and navigation options. High-resolution touchscreens, voice control, and gesture recognition simplify the user experience.
* **Advanced Safety Features:** Luxury cars often come equipped with an array of advanced safety technologies, including ad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ning, blind spot monitoring, and automatic emergency braking, all of which enhance driver confidence and safety.
* **Luxury Features:** Beyond the core technologies, luxury cars often offer a range of features designed to pamper and entertain. Features like heated and ventilated seats, massaging seats, premium sound systems, and multi-zone climate control contribute to a luxurious and personalized driving experience.
## The Artistry of Space: Design and Ergonomics
The design of a luxury car interior is a delicate balance between artistry and functionality. Designers strive to create spaces that are not only visually appealing but also comfortable and intuitive to use.
* **Sculpted Lines:** The contours of the dashboard, seats, and door panels are meticulously sculpted to create a sense of flow and cohesion. These lines not only enhance the aesthetics but also contribute to the overall feeling of spaciousness.
* **Ergonomics:** The layout of the controls and the positioning of the seats are designed for optimal comfort and ease of use. Everything, from the angle of the steering wheel to the reach of the gear shifter, is carefully considered to minimize driver fatigue and maximize driver satisfaction.
* **Ambiance:** The use of lighting plays a crucial role in shaping the ambiance of the cabin. Ambient lighting, using LED strips and strategically placed lights, creates a calming and inviting atmosphere, while mood lighting allows for customizable color schemes to match the driver’s mood or preferences.
* **Sound:** Luxury car interiors are often designed with acoustic considerations in mind. Noise reduction techniques, such as sound-deadening materials and strategically placed insulation, create a peaceful and refined driving experience, allowing passengers to truly appreciate the symphony of the engine or the tranquility of the road.
## Beyond the Typical: Innovative Interior Features
Luxury carmakers are constantly pushing the boundaries of interior design and technology, introducing innovative features that redefine the driving experience.
* **Virtual Reality Configurators:** Some manufacturers offer virtual reality (VR) configurators that allow potential buyers to experience the interior design and features of a car before they even step foot in a showroom. VR technology provides a realistic and immersive experience, allowing consumers to customize their dream car with confidence.
* **Personalized Lighting:** Some luxury car interiors incorporate advanced lighting systems that allow drivers to personalize the ambiance of the cabin. Color-changing LEDs, programmable lighting, and interactive light shows transform the interior into a dynamic and responsive space.
* **Augmented Reality Displays:** Augmented reality (AR) displays overlay digital information onto a real-world view, enhancing the driver’s awareness and providing a more immersive driving experience. AR navigation systems, for example, can project turn-by-turn directions onto the windshield, making it easier to navigate unfamiliar roads.
* **Interactive Surfaces:** Luxury car interiors are increasingly incorporating interactive surfaces that respond to touch and gesture. Touch-sensitive controls, gesture recognition software, and holographic displays enhance the user experience and streamline interactions within the cabin.
* **Sustainable Materials:** As environmental consciousness grows, luxury carmakers are embracing sustainable materials in their interiors. Recycled materials, renewable resources, and ethically sourced materials are becoming increasingly popular, demonstrating a commitment to sustainable luxury.
## The Cost of Luxury
The opulence of luxury car interiors comes at a price. Premium materials, advanced technologies, and meticulous craftsmanship all contribute to the high cost of these vehicles.
* **Materials:** The use of exotic leathers, precious woods, and rare metals pushes the price tag higher.
* **Craftsmanship:** Hand-stitched leather, intricate wood veneers, and meticulous assembly all require skilled labor, adding to the overall cost.
* **Technology:** Advanced infotainment systems, head-up displays, and driver assistance technologies are expensive to develop, manufacture, and integrate into the vehicle.
* **Exclusivity:** Limited edition trims and materials, often associated with bespoke customization, increase the value and desirability of the vehicle, further boosting the price tag.
